What Exactly Is a Man Hole Cover Round?

Simply put, a man hole cover round is a circular plate, often made from cast iron or composite materials, designed to seal access points to underground utilities. The round shape isn’t accidental: it prevents the cover from falling through the opening because, unlike squares, you can’t rotate and drop a round cover diagonally. It also evenly distributes weight, which is great when you think about heavy trucks rolling over these covers daily.

Beyond its geometric charm, this cover is an integral piece of modern urban life. It’s the gatekeeper for sewer systems, telecommunication cables, storm drains, and even electric conduits. Core Factors Behind a Great Man Hole Cover Round

1. Durability and Load Capacity

These covers bear immense loads — think buses or delivery trucks — so materials like ductile iron or reinforced composites are common. They pass rigorous load tests that often exceed 40 tonnes. Durability also means resisting corrosion and weathering, especially in coastal or industrial areas.

2. Safety and Security

Locking mechanisms and anti-theft features are often integrated to prevent unauthorized access or theft for scrap metal. Safety is also about slip resistance; many covers sport textured surfaces to prevent pedestrian accidents.

3. Ease of Maintenance and Installation

Modular designs or ergonomic handles can reduce the effort and risk technicians face during inspections. Quick installation is a boon during emergency repairs.

4. Environmental Resistance

Exposure to chemicals, saltwater, or extreme temperatures demands covers that won’t degrade quickly. For example, coastal cities opt for polymer concrete covers to fight corrosion.

Technical Specifications of a Typical Man Hole Cover Round

Specification Details
Diameter 600 mm (Standard)
Material Ductile Iron / Polymer Concrete
Load Rating Class D400 (up to 40 tonnes)
Surface Anti-slip Pattern
Finish Epoxy Coating (Optional)
Weight Between 25 - 40 kg

Emerging Trends & Innovations in Man Hole Cover Round Technology

The field isn’t standing still: smart man hole covers embedded with sensors are enabling remote monitoring for faults or theft. Some companies are experimenting with solar-powered LED markers for night visibility. Material science advances offer composites that match strength but cut weight and carbon footprint drastically.

Additionally, automation in manufacturing helps standardize quality and lower costs. Policies in Europe and parts of Asia increasingly mandate sustainable sourcing and recyclability for infrastructure components — pushing innovation further.

Common Challenges and How the Industry is Responding

Though the concept seems straightforward, real-world hurdles abound. Covers can corrode, shift, or get stolen for scrap value. In cold climates, freeze-thaw cycles can warp them. Manufacturing discrepancies mean some batches don’t fit precisely, causing wobble or unsafe conditions.

To combat these, quality control improvements, locking mechanisms, and corrosion-resistant coatings are commonplace. In remote areas, modular covers designed for easy repair or replacement cut downtime. Urban planners increasingly involve these considerations early in infrastructure projects, rather than as afterthoughts.

FAQ: Frequently Asked Questions About Man Hole Cover Round

Q1: What makes round man hole covers preferable over square or rectangular ones?
A: The round shape ensures the cover cannot accidentally fall into the hole no matter how it is positioned. This simple geometric advantage prevents accidents and loss, making round covers the global standard.
Q2: How long does a typical man hole cover round last under normal urban conditions?
A: With proper materials and maintenance, covers can last 20 to 30 years or more. Factors like traffic load, environment, and coating quality influence longevity.
Q3: Are there eco-friendly options for man hole covers?
A: Yes, manufacturers now offer covers fabricated from recycled polymers or composite materials, reducing environmental impact while maintaining strength and durability.
Q4: How do engineers test the load-bearing capacity of these covers?
A: Load testing involves applying static and dynamic weights according to international standards (e.g., EN 124) to ensure the cover withstands expected traffic without deformation or failure.
